Wasn't sure from your first post whether the suspected bad batch had ethanol. Also wasn't sure whether that was the first ethanol mix that went in the boat. I have heard that most tanks that live with non-ethanol fuel get a buildup of sludgy varnish inside, and that ethanol breaks that stuff loose but then puts it through to the motors. Such that when a boat first starts getting ethanol, it may clog the fuel filters a couple of times until that varnishy stuff is gone. Just a thought, but I'm curious if perhaps the new filters you just put in are already clogging.

At first, I couldn't get past the octane theory...but, if you have a Thunderbolt V ignition system (and I think those motors did), the computer will read a knock code and decrease ignition timing automatically until the knock stops. Effectively reducing HP and RPM.
This could indeed be your situation seeing how it affected both engine's RPMs.
And the only thing that would tip you off is the decrease in performance.
